Played a scenario similar to this on the 23rd. There were about 8-10 people playing or so, and we had it such that the VIP (me) had to make it from the emergency exit on the Embassy side to the bank.
Actually worked quite well. Pushed up through A building with my team, and finally made it when I put my guns down and sprinted from the door of A into the bank with 30 seconds left (I think we had lost 75% of our team at this point).
Everybody was two hits, except the VIP who was three.
May want to make it in the future that the VIP is limited to a pistol or semi-auto, because at one point I hit two or three people at once when I got the drop on them (I wouldn't expect a VIP to open fire with well aimed full auto in real life).

we did this a couple weeks ago, outdoors. The scenario was the SecDef's plane was shot down in Serbia, and he was the lone survivor. The US gov't contacted and hired a PMC named DynaCorp, who had a team nearby, that could get there faster than a regular military force. There mission was to locate, and escort the VIP to the LZ for extraction. The Serb forces were looking for survivors of the wreckage, and had basic intel on the general location of the LZ. Our VIP had a handgun, PASGT, and real body armor on (thanks, itsahak). The VIP could be killed, but if he was, the Serbs lost, as their mission was to capture and transport to their HQ for interrogation. Depending on where the VIP got hit, he would not necessarily be dead...say a limb shot, would just disable him, until a medic could heal him (using medic ropes). Playing on the Serbs team, we hunted down and wiped out the DynaCorp guys, and shot the VIP in the leg, dropping him to the ground. As the DC guys were waiting to respawn, I put the VIP on my shoulder ( he was about 6'3" and 230lbs) and started sprinting back to our base, with the rest of my team, protecting my six. Serbs won.
All in all, a really fun game, one I would play again.
